购买
下载掌阅APP,畅读海量书库
立即打开
畅读海量书库
扫码下载掌阅APP

前言

为什么要写这本书

这是一个真正的数据大爆炸时代,看得见,摸得着。

我们每天都在生产数据:发朋友圈、发微博、上传图片和视频到社交网站、备份数据到网盘等。我们的这些数据,不是存储在虚无缥缈的云端,而是存储在云服务器上。云服务器的核心就是存储介质。无论是云端存储,还是本地存储,有数据的地方就有存储介质。

传统数据存储介质有磁带、光盘等,但更多的是硬盘(HDD)。随着数据呈爆炸式增长,对数据存储介质在速度上、容量上有更高的要求。时势造英雄,固态硬盘(Solid State Disk,SSD)横空出世。SSD使用电子芯片存储数据,没有HDD的机械式部件,因此在速度、时延、功耗、抗震等方面,与HDD相比有碾压式优势。无论是个人存储,还是企业存储,都在逐渐用SSD取代HDD。大数据时代,SSD必将是主角。

HDD时代我们错过了;SSD时代,我们迎来了弯道超车的好机会。国内很多企业都希望抓住这个机遇,所以他们研发、制造SSD,并且取得了不错的成绩,已经有了能自主研发SSD及SSD控制器的公司。国家层面也在大力研发半导体。长江存储的成立昭示了国家对固态存储这块的态度和决心。

国内SSD领域的从业人员,以及日常使用SSD的人越来越多,但是市面上专门介绍SSD技术的中文书籍少之又少。作为国内领先的SSD技术社区——SSDFans有责任、有义务,也有动力推出一本中文版SSD技术书籍。

我们几位作者,都工作在SSD的最前线,是工程师出身,虽文笔一般但是热情十足,愿意分享对技术的理解。希望这块砖头能够帮助您敲开SSD的大门,如果能够解决您的一些实际问题,或者引发您的一些思考,我们更是不胜荣幸。

最后,欢迎您通过网站( http://www.ssdfans.com )、微信公众号(SSDFans)来进一步了解我们,与我们做进一步的交流。

读者对象

·计算机、电子相关专业的在校本科生,存储方向的研究生:通过阅读本书,能够更好地将所学的理论与业界实践结合,对相关知识有更加深刻的理解,为未来加入企业打好坚实的基础。

·SSD研发企业的员工:通过阅读本书,可以全面学习与SSD相关的硬件、协议、固件以及测试等各方面的基础知识,提升整体认知,具备完整、系统的理论知识。

·企业IT运维人员:通过阅读本书,可以充分了解SSD的优劣之处及其适用的工作场景,为公司的IT部署过程提供技术支持,实现整体运营成本的最优配置。

·广大的DIY、游戏爱好者:通过阅读本书,可以学会如何选择最适合自己的SSD,以合理投入获得更好的娱乐体验。

·对SSD产业感兴趣的投资人:通过阅读本书,可以全面了解SSD产业的现状,掌握基本的技术术语,以便更好地与企业沟通。

·其他对SSD知识感兴趣的人。

本书特色

本书的作者团队都在业内知名公司任职,具备丰富的理论和实践知识。同时,日常维护公众号期间,跟读者的频繁互动也保证了知识的更新速度。

在撰写本书的过程中,作者们能够对技术原理做深入浅出的阐述,并结合自身工作经验给出意见。

本书主要内容

本书的内容几乎覆盖了SSD各个模块,既可以作为一本入门书籍进行通读,也可以在需要的时候作为工具书进行查阅。

本书内容涵盖:SSD基础知识、SSD各模块介绍及SSD测试相关内容。

SSD基础知识包括:SSD与HDD的比较、SSD的发展历史、产品形态、整体架构和基本工作原理。

模块介绍包括:

·FTL闪存转换层:作为SSD固件的核心部分,FTL实现了例如映射管理、磨损均衡、垃圾回收、坏块管理等诸多功能,本书将一一介绍。

·NAND Flash:NAND Flash作为SSD的存储介质,具有很多与传统磁介质不同的特性,本书将从器件原理、实战指南、闪存特性及数据完整性等方面展开。

·NVMe存储协议:作为专门为SSD开发的软件存储协议,NVMe正在迅速占领SSD市场。本书将从其优势、基础架构、寻址方式、数据安全等方面展开。为了让读者对NVMe命令处理有更加直观的认识,本书结合实际的PCIe trace进行阐述。同时,本书也介绍了NVMe Over Fabric的相关知识,让读者能够对未来网络与存储的发展趋势有所了解。

·PCIe协议:PCIe作为目前主流的SSD前端总线,与之前的SATA接口相比有着极大的性能优势。本书将从PCIe总线拓扑结构、分层结构、TLP类型与路由、配置和地址空间等方面进行介绍。

·电源管理:本书详述了SSD前端总线(包括SATA和PCIe)的各种节能模式、NVMe协议的电源管理方案及在SSD里常用的整体电源管理架构——Power Domain。

·ECC:本书介绍了ECC的基本概念,重点介绍了LDPC的解码和编码原理,以及在NAND上的应用。

SSD测试的内容包括:本书详述了常用的测试软件、测试流程、仪器设备、业界认证及专业的测试标准等。

勘误和支持

由于作者的水平有限,再加上时间仓促,书中难免会出现一些错误或者不准确的地方,恳请读者批评指正。您可通过我们的网站( http://www.ssdfans.com )、微信公众号(或微博)SSDFans、阿呆的微信号(nanoarchplus)或阿呆的邮箱( adam@ssdfas.com )随时与我们进行交流。

致谢

借此机会特别感谢一直以来支持SSDFans的各位朋友(排名不分先后)——冬瓜哥、唐杰、路向峰、廖莎、兵哥、邰总、古猫先生、袁戎、顾沧海、山哥(Brown)等。

感谢机械工业出版社华章公司的编辑杨福川和孙海亮,在这一年多的时间中他们始终支持我们这几个门外汉,他们的鼓励和帮助引导我们顺利完成全部书稿。

谨以此书献给亲爱的家人,以及众多支持SSDFans的朋友们! aExVXQNwuo/o/KAMZae1sa5sLvlfIetUU2fuIYxhlWTOnvPW8wyY6iy6/KThqTdF

点击中间区域
呼出菜单
上一章
目录
下一章
×